IsDown checks Lever official status page for major/minor outages or downtimes. A major outage is when Lever experiences a critical issue that severely affects one or more services/regions. A minor incident is when Lever experiences a small issue affecting a small percentage of its customer's applications. An example is the performance degradation of an application.
